Austin's weather is set to maintain its clear, sunny disposition with uninterrupted stretches of heat for this week. Temps will soar close to the high 90s, with this afternoon expected to peak at around 96 degrees, according to the National Weather Service. Evenings will offer a slight reprieve; tonight's low should hover around 72 degrees.

The weekend forecast promises more of the same sunshine without a cloud in sight. Saturday's high once again tips the scales near 95 with a light breeze making its presence known later in the afternoon. The weather stays consistent on Sunday, with temperatures expected to climb; nighttime lows will offer little relief, just nudging into the low 70s. A calm wind settles in after midnight, easing into a soft southeast whisper.

Monday's forecast suggests slight changes on the horizon, with a 20 percent chance of showers and thunderstorms post-1pm, though the sun will likely stay dominant, keeping the high near 97 degrees. The evening maintains a continued chance for showers until the early hours, despite the persistent warmth of the low 70s.

Come Tuesday, Austin may encounter increased chances for wet weather—a 40 percent shot at showers and thunderstorms after the afternoon kicks in, the mercury is expected to push even higher, flirting with a near 98-degree high. The sky clears again at night, but the potential for precipitation lingers around an unassuming 20 percent chance.

As midweek approaches, the city anticipates more instances of potential showers and thunderstorms, with Wednesday showing a 30 percent chance for moisture amidst yet another mostly sunny day capped at a high of around 95. Temperatures at night withdraw slightly, making their way down to 72. Looking forward, Thursday could see a slight continuation of the week’s light shower trend, though sunshine is likely to prevail, accompanied by a high near 94.
